Skylar Diggins Out For Rest of WNBA Season With Torn ACL

Tulsa Shock all-star guard Skylar Diggins will miss the rest of the WNBA season after suffering a torn right anterior cruciate ligament injury in last Sunday's game.

Aaron Hernandez's Request to Have Murder Conviction Tossed Rejected by Trial Judge

A Massachusetts Superior Court judge has dismissed former NFL star Aaron Hernandez's request that his recent first-degree murder conviction be thrown out or reduced.
